Does adding another person to Face ID on my iPad allow them to access my iPhone?

I’ve bought an iPad, logged in with my Apple ID, and added my girlfriend’s face on Face ID so she can unlock and use the iPad. However I’m wondering, as a lot of things are synced between the two devices, does that mean that my girlfriend can now pick up my iphone and use Face ID to access it? Or are the Face ID settings distinct for each device?

Face ID is per device.


So no, it does not give her access to your iPhone.
